• v26.2.20.1 7e079ea67e

    v26.2.20.1 Stable

    kerem released this 2026-02-20 21:12:54 +03:00 | 146 commits to main since this release

    📅 Originally published on GitHub: Fri, 20 Feb 2026 18:14:01 GMT
    🏷️ Git tag created: Fri, 20 Feb 2026 18:12:54 GMT

    🚀 v26.2.20.1 — IPSet Menu Yeniden Duzenleme & Guvenlik

    Surum Tipi: Minor Feature / Fix
    Odak: IPSet istemci menusu yeniden duzenlendi, toplu IP girisi dogrulamasi eklendi, CLI kisayollari genisletildi

    Yeni Ozellikler

    • kzm ve KZM CLI kisayollari eklendikeenetic-zapret ve keenetic ile birlikte artik kzm veya KZM yazarak da script baslatilabilir
      • Her iki kisayol da ensure_cli_shortcut tarafindan otomatik olusturulur (yoksa)
      • KZM tam kaldirma sirasinda bu kisayollar da temizlenir

    Iyilestirmeler

    • IPSet istemci menusu yeniden duzenlendi — "Mevcut IP Listesini Goster" secenegi 1 numaraya alindi
      • Liste goruntuleme her zaman 1. sirada kalacak, ileriki eklemelerden etkilenmeyecek
      • Yeni siralama: 1=Liste Goster, 2=Tum Aga Uygula, 3=Secili IP'lere Uygula, 4=Tek IP Ekle, 5=Tek IP Sil, 6=No Zapret Yonetimi
    • Toplu IP girisi dogrulamasi eklendi — Gecersiz formattaki satirlar (ornegin 192.168.1.1; rm -rf /opt) dosyaya yazilmadan filtrelenir
      • Sadece x.x.x.x formatindaki IPv4 adresleri kabul edilir
      • Kac satirin atildigini kullaniciya bildirir
      • Private IP aralikları (10.x, 172.x, 192.168.x) engellenmez

    ⚙️ Notlar

    • IPSet menu numaralari degistigi icin aliskanliklari olan kullanicilar yeni siraya alismalidir
    • kzm/KZM kisayollari mevcut kurulumda bir kez keenetic-zapret calistirildiktan sonra otomatik olusur
    • Mevcut kurulumlar guvenle guncellenebilir, hicbir yapilandirma dosyasina dokunulmaz

    🚀 v26.2.20.1 — IPSet Menu Reorder & Security

    Release Type: Minor Feature / Fix
    Focus: IPSet client menu reordered, bulk IP input validation added, CLI shortcuts expanded

    New Features

    • kzm and KZM CLI shortcuts added — script can now be launched by typing kzm or KZM in addition to keenetic-zapret and keenetic
      • Both shortcuts are created automatically by ensure_cli_shortcut (if not present)
      • Removed during full KZM uninstall

    Improvements

    • IPSet client menu reordered — "Show Current IP List" moved to position 1
      • List view will always stay at position 1, unaffected by future additions
      • New order: 1=Show List, 2=Apply to Whole Network, 3=Apply to Selected IPs, 4=Add Single IP, 5=Remove Single IP, 6=No Zapret Management
    • Bulk IP input validation added — lines with invalid format (e.g. 192.168.1.1; rm -rf /opt) are filtered before writing to file
      • Only x.x.x.x format IPv4 addresses accepted
      • Reports how many lines were skipped
      • Private IP ranges (10.x, 172.x, 192.168.x) are not blocked

    ⚙️ Notes

    • IPSet menu numbers have changed; users familiar with the old layout should note the new order
    • kzm/KZM shortcuts are created automatically after running keenetic-zapret once on existing installations
    • Existing installations can be safely updated, no configuration files are modified
    Downloads